Remant Alton buys 140 buses for Durban service.(News)

From: The Mercury (South Africa) | Date: July 13, 2007 | Copyright information

BYLINE: Greg Dardagan

Mercedes-Benz is supplying 140 new buses in a deal worth more than R100 million to help upgrade and modernise the public bus service in the greater Durban area.

The chassis for 94 of the new 65-seater buses will come from the Mercedes-Benz factory in East London, with the bodies being added at plants in Johannesburg before delivery to Remant Alton Land Transport, which operates the Durban bus service for the eThekwini Municipality.
